36  The baptismal prayer is found in the scriptures.  Listen to these words found in Doctrine and Covenants 20:73, starting with the words “Having been commissioned.”

37 “...Having been commissioned of Jesus Christ, I baptize you in the name of the Father, and of the Son, and of the Holy Ghost. Amen.”

38  “Commissioned means “given authority to represent.”  A true baptism is performed only by someone who has been given the authority to represent Jesus Christ in performing the baptism.  Their baptism will have the same value as if Jesus himself had baptized them.

39  After saying the prayer, the man who is baptizing puts his right hand on the person’s back and gently lowers him into the water until the water completely covers him.  Then he lifts the person up out of the water.

40  You are only under water for a short time and that the man baptizing them will hold them firmly.  They will hold his arm and will be able to hold their noses so they won’t breathe or swallow any water.
